Abstract

General characteristics of smelting. In the practice of heavy non-ferrous metals production, new technological processes are becoming increasingly widespread, based on improving the conditions of heat and mass transfer, using oxygen and heated blast (due to secondary energy resources) as an intensifier, and using more economical types of fuel ...
